Damaged underside of car - Black strutt

Hi guys, haven't been around in a while. The RX8 has been going along nicely and nearly 5 years old now.

Well tonight i am a little pissed off. Visited a friend who had just moved into a new house. Was driving into the driveway when BANG, the underside of the car was hammered.

After getting out of the car it seems there was about a 4 inch high steel plate in the middle of the driveway where the gate locks. Unfortunately since the driveway was uphill i was unable to see it.

Anyway it has ripped the crap out of the black strut about 3/4 of the way down the car above the exhaust. Its dark outside so i can't see properly but i think its the black strut as shown in this pic https://www.rx8club.com/attachment.p...9&d=1115734697

Any idea on what i should do. It will obviously need to be replaced but if i am going to fork over $ should i go after market?

Firstly, that's not a strut ... that's a crossmember

Secondly ... how bad is it? I doubt it would've ripped it, but how badly damaged is it? Can you please provide photos so we can let you know?

Thirdly, you can't go aftermarket, that's something you'll need to buy genuine, however you may be able to find one at a wrecker. Maybe not from a car that's had serious front-side damage, but from one that's had either a straight head-on or mid-rear side damage.

If it looks like you've damaged anything else your insurance company would be your next point of call.
